Abstract

This research aimed at determining whether the Team Game method can increasephysical fitness on the fifth grade students of Yogyakarta Muhammadiyah elementaryschool Condongcatur. The research was carried out in Yogyakarta Muhammadiyahelementary school Condongcatur from July to October 2014. Further, the subject of thisresearch was the fifth grade students of Yogyakarta Muhammadiyah elementary schoolCondongcatur schooling year 2014-2015 consisting of 40 students who are 21 maleand 19 female students. This research implemented Classroom Action Research (CAR)within the analysis by comparing the precondition of students, test results after the firstcycle and test results after the second cycle. Based on the research findings, it could beconcluded that the team game method could be used as an attempt to increase the physicalfitness of students on the fifth grade elementary school children Condongcatur YogyakartaMuhammadiyah schooling year 2014/2015 which was proved from the study that has beencarried out in the first cycle and the second cycle. Almost all students experienced thesignificant increase in physical fitness. This was also proved that after the first cycle test,there is only one student whose physical fitness test is less. After the second cycle was thencarried out, there is no longer student of whose physical fitness test is low

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the relationship between anthropometric variables and biomotor abilities with gymnastics potential in elementary school students. The research method used a correlational quantitative approach involving 106 fourth and fifth grade students aged 9–11 years at SD Negeri 1 Gentan. Data were collected through anthropometric measurements (height, weight, arm span, sitting height) and biomotor ability tests (flexibility, core muscle strength, coordination). Data analysis was performed using Pearson's correlation test and multiple regression using SPSS. The results of the study showed that: (1) Height was significantly correlated with arm span (r = 0.687; p < 0.01) and sitting height (r = 0.434; p < 0.01), but not with biomotor ability; (2) Sit height has a positive relationship with core muscle strength (plank) (r = 0.346; p < 0.01), while arm span has a negative correlation (r = -0.209; p < 0.05); (3) Biomechanical abilities such as flexibility (split) and body rotation (air turn) are significantly correlated (r = 0.775 and r = 0.676; p < 0.01), but are not directly influenced by anthropometric variables. The conclusions of this study indicate that gymnastics potential is more influenced by technical training and flexibility than by body structure, although certain anthropometric variables such as sitting height and arm span play a role in core muscle stability. The implications of this study highlight the importance of combining anthropometric monitoring with structured biomotor training programs for the development of gymnastics potential in elementary school students. Abstract

This study aims to examine the physical education learning model based on CGFU PM-515 on improving forward roll skills in elementary school students in Sleman Regency. The method used is quasi-experimental with a one-group pretest-posttest design. The research subjects were 117 students from four elementary schools, namely SD Negeri Condongcatur, SD Muhammadiyah Condongcatur, SD Negeri Deresan, and SD Negeri Percobaan 2. Data collection techniques were carried out through skill tests, knowledge tests, and attitude questionnaires. Data analysis began with normality and homogeneity tests, followed by the Wilcoxon Signed Ranks Test due to non-normally distributed data and partially non-homogeneous data. The results showed a significant difference between pretest and posttest scores in the variables of skills, knowledge, and attitude with a significance value of 0.000 < 0.05. These results prove that the implementation of the CGFU PM-515-based physical education learning model has a significant impact on improving forward roll skills in elementary school students. Thus, the CGFU PM-515 learning model can be used as an effective and innovative alternative learning model for physical education in elementary schools.
